Output efc1a772ca30c804bca1a225c3d36876c213055fd791348613b65f4d8b352414:29

value
76661
script pubkey
OP_0 OP_PUSHBYTES_20 8cd175e8032a2bb4ef9b314a437e1f1fe245a313
address
bc1q3nght6qr9g4mfmumx99yxlslrl3ytgcnu87frx
transaction
efc1a772ca30c804bca1a225c3d36876c213055fd791348613b65f4d8b352414